## Deployment — Driftplan calendar sync

Driftplan's sync engine resolves overlapping edits between the Hollowmere scheduler and external calendars using a last-writer-wins policy with a tombstone window. During deployment, drain the conflict queue fully before switching traffic, because in-flight conflict records written under the old schema cannot be replayed by the new resolver. Verify queue depth is zero, then restart the resolver with the configuration values listed below.

settings of tagef-bawif:
DRUIX_HOST=druix.zemvarlabs.internal
DRUIX_PORT=8000

Handover: Glimmer template rendering perf work.

Current state: partial-cache layer landed behind flag render_cache_v2. Hot path is escapeAndInline(); it skips sanitization when cache hits — review that carefully before flag goes default. Benchmarks in perf/glimmer-bench, run nightly. Known gap: cache keys don't include locale, fix pending. Do not enable on the Vexley tenant until audited. All open questions about the sanitization bypass should be routed to the person named below.

named custodian: Brivan Eliath Quenox Frador

Runbook: GraphTrellis refresh

If the dependency graph visualizer shows stale edges, restart the edge-builder job and wait five minutes for the cache to rebuild. Confirm node counts match yesterday's snapshot within five percent. The builder reads directly from the manifest store, and it connects using this string:

replica DSN, kajep-yahag: mssql://praok_svc:iF@db-8d68.plorvaio.local:5432/eliion

Hello plugin authors,

Next Thursday, Corbexa will run a disaster-recovery drill for the RestockRoute vending-machine restock planner. During the failover window, plugin callbacks will be replayed against the standby scheduler, so please ensure your handlers are idempotent and tolerate duplicate route assignments. No customer restock data will be altered. To re-register your plugin against the standby environment during the drill, authenticate with the recovery passphrase provided below.

vault phrase of hahip-tajeg = quenax-briath-briax